Prospection of plant-based bio-insecticides for mosquito vector control in Tanzania: A comprehensive review

Abstract

. Despite encouraging findings, most studies remain laboratory-based, emphasizing the need for expanded field trials, improved extraction methods, and formulation development to harness Tanzania's rich plant biodiversity for sustainable mosquito vector control.
